A Google Business Profile is the listing that appears when someone searches for your business name or services on Google.
It can show:
Your business name and location
Phone number and website
Hours of operation
Photos
Customer reviews
Directions on Google Maps
If your business serves a local area, having a verified profile is essential.
Before creating a new profile, make sure Google doesn’t already have one.
Go to google.com/business
Sign in with a Google account
Search for your business name
If your business appears:
You may be able to claim it
Or request access if someone else manages it
If it doesn’t appear, you can create a new profile.
Visit google.com/business
Click “Manage now”
Enter your business name
Choose the most accurate business category
Add your location or service area
Enter your contact details (phone, website)
Be accurate — your information should match what’s on your website and other listings.
Google requires verification to confirm you’re a legitimate business.
Verification methods may include:
Postcard mailed to your business address
Phone call or text
Video verification (showing your location or equipment)
Verification usually takes a few days, depending on the method.
Once verified, finish setting up your profile:
Add business hours
Upload photos (logo, storefront, team, or work)
Write a clear business description
Set service areas if you don’t have a physical storefront
A complete profile performs better in search results.
Reviews play a major role in visibility and trust.
Once your profile is live:
Share your Google review link with customers
Ask for feedback after completed visits, appointments, or projects
Respond to reviews to show engagement
This is where tools like Review Web can help simplify the process.
Creating duplicate listings
Using a PO Box or virtual office incorrectly
Keyword stuffing your business name
Ignoring verification requests
Leaving your profile incomplete
These issues can delay approval or limit visibility.
While Google Business Profile setup is free, managing reviews consistently can be time-consuming.
Review Web helps businesses:
Collect Google reviews more easily
Share review links and QR codes
Monitor feedback in one place
Respond faster and more consistently
You can manage your Google presence manually — or use tools designed to make it easier.
A Google Business Profile is essential for local visibility
Setup is free and only takes a few steps
Verification is required before your profile goes live
Reviews play a major role in ranking and trust
If you don’t have a Google Business Profile yet, getting started today is one of the best things you can do for your business.
